Kebbi State, located in the northwestern region of Nigeria, has been making significant strides in enhancing its secondary school education system. This comprehensive overview delves into the current state of secondary education in Kebbi, highlighting the most populated schools, the roles of government education agencies, and the policies shaping the educational landscape.
1. Secondary Education in Kebbi State
Secondary education in Kebbi State serves as a critical bridge between primary education and tertiary institutions. It encompasses both Junior Secondary Schools (JSS) and Senior Secondary Schools (SSS), aiming to provide students with the necessary knowledge and skills for higher education and vocational pursuits.
2. Current Landscape of Secondary Schools
As of recent data, Kebbi State boasts a substantial number of secondary schools, both public and private. The state’s commitment to education is evident in its efforts to increase school enrollment and improve infrastructure.
3. Enrollment Statistics
The Universal Basic Education Commission (UBEC) audit revealed that Kebbi State has registered approximately 857,185 pupils and students in primary and junior secondary schools. Of these, 65% are enrolled in public schools, while 35% attend private institutions. This significant enrollment underscores the state’s dedication to providing accessible education for all. thenationonlineng.net
4. Infrastructure Development Initiatives
Recognizing the importance of a conducive learning environment, the Kebbi State Government has invested heavily in educational infrastructure. Notably, over ₦2 billion has been allocated for the provision of school furniture in public primary and secondary schools between 2015 and 2018. This investment ensures that students have access to adequate learning facilities, thereby enhancing the quality of education.

6. Government Education Agencies
The administration and regulation of secondary education in Kebbi State involve several key government agencies:
- Kebbi State Ministry of Basic and Secondary Education: This ministry oversees the implementation of educational policies, curriculum development, and quality assurance in schools.
- Kebbi State Universal Basic Education Board (SUBEB): Responsible for managing basic education, SUBEB plays a pivotal role in infrastructure development, teacher recruitment, and monitoring educational standards.
- Teaching Service Board (TSB): This board handles matters related to the welfare, training, and promotion of teachers within the state’s secondary schools.
7. Educational Policies and Reforms
The Kebbi State Government has introduced several policies aimed at enhancing the quality of secondary education:
- Teacher Welfare Enhancement: In a bid to attract and retain qualified educators, the government has increased teacher salaries and extended the retirement age from 60 to 65 years. This policy ensures that experienced teachers continue to contribute to the educational system. vanguardngr.com
- Infrastructure Development: The state has committed substantial funds towards the construction and renovation of schools. For instance, ₦2.4 billion was approved for the construction of 82 new classrooms and the renovation of 22 others, alongside the provision of 7,215 pieces of furniture to various schools. constructionreviewonline.com
- School Feeding Program: To encourage student enrollment and retention, the government increased its monthly expenditure on the school feeding program from ₦200 million to ₦350 million. This initiative ensures that students receive nutritious meals, which is essential for their academic performance and overall well-being. nairametrics.com
- Free Education Policy: The administration has implemented a free education policy that covers examination registration, tuition fees, and scholarships for students in both secondary and tertiary institutions. This policy alleviates the financial burden on parents and promotes higher school attendance rates. vanguardngr.com
8. Focus on Girl-Child Education
Understanding the cultural and socio-economic barriers that hinder girls’ education, Kebbi State has launched initiatives to promote gender inclusivity:
- Construction of Mega Schools: The government has embarked on constructing mega schools designed to provide a conducive learning environment, particularly for girls. These schools are equipped with modern facilities to encourage female enrollment and retention.
- Financial Support: Significant funds have been allocated to support female students. For example, ₦50 million was donated to Command Science Secondary School, Girls, Goru, to enhance its infrastructure and resources. vanguardngr.com
9. Addressing Out-of-School Children
Kebbi State faces challenges with a high number of out-of-school children, attributed to factors such as cultural practices and economic constraints. To combat this issue:
- Establishment of Learning Centers: The government has set up numerous non-formal learning centers aimed at integrating out-of-school children into the educational system. These centers offer flexible learning schedules and curricula tailored to the needs of these children.
- Nomadic Education Programs: Recognizing the unique lifestyle of nomadic communities, specialized schools have been established to provide education that accommodates their migratory patterns. punchng.com
10. Teacher Recruitment and Training
A robust educational system relies heavily on the quality of its teachers. Kebbi State has undertaken measures to ensure a competent teaching workforce:
- Recruitment Drives: To address teacher shortages, the government approved the hiring of 2,000 new teachers across the state. This initiative aims to reduce student-to-teacher ratios and improve the quality of instruction. vanguardngr.com
- Professional Development: Continuous training programs have been instituted to enhance teachers’ pedagogical skills, ensuring they are well-equipped to deliver the curriculum effectively.
